- Thigh liposuction: Key factors that determine its effects

When many people consider thigh liposuction,
they may first wonder how much fat will be removed.
However, the amount removed is not the only factor that determines actual satisfaction.
The distribution of fat on the inner and outer thighs,
as well as the front and back,
differs from person to person,
and the shape of the pelvis and knees,
along with the degree of muscle development,
must also be considered.
Rather than removing an excessive amount of fat without consideration,

planning the lines with overall balance in mind
may help achieve a more natural-looking result.
In addition, analyzing skin elasticity together with the current body shape may increase the likelihood that the change will appear more natural.
- Line design, which is more important than fat removal
The purpose of thigh liposuction is not to reduce body weight,
but to create more balanced proportions and a silhouette for the legs.
Even when the same amount of fat is removed,
the overall impression may vary depending on the design.
The space between the inner thighs, the continuity around the knees,
the curve of the outer line, and the proportions connecting to the hips
must all be considered
to help create a smooth silhouette.

In particular, if too much fat is removed from only a specific area,
there is a possibility that an uneven appearance or unnatural contours may develop,
so a design process that considers overall harmony is important.

Ultimately, satisfaction
may depend not on how much was removed,
but on how naturally the contours connect.
- How satisfaction varies according to the recovery process

The recovery process is also an important part of thigh liposuction.
In the early stages, swelling, a feeling of tightness, and bruising may occur,
and changes may gradually continue over time.
During this period, strenuous exercise or excessive activity may affect recovery,
so it is advisable to consistently follow the recommended care instructions.

Wearing compression garments, taking light walks, and getting sufficient rest
are care methods frequently recommended during recovery.
In addition, the rate at which swelling subsides
and the time required for the contours to settle
may vary from person to person.
Rather than judging the final result too early,
it may lead to a more satisfactory assessment to observe the progress sufficiently.
